Anxiety is high in Nairobi and various parts of the country in anticipation of the youth-led protests set to take place on Thursday.

The demonstrators have vowed to stage a daring march to State House as the climax of a seven-day protest to express their anger and dissatisfaction with the current government of President William Ruto.

After the deadly rallies witnessed on Tuesday when the protestors invaded Parliament in protest of the Finance Bill 2024, security teams appear determined to thwart any attempt to access the House on the Hill.

Elite security teams have sealed off all roads leading to State House with military deployment spotted in Nairobi.
